    Claressa Shields has endured plenty of criticism over her career-long "GWOAT" (Greatest Woman of All Time) claim as it relates to female boxers. The two-time Olympic Gold medalist and two-division champion in the pro ranks certainly looked the part in a tour-de-force performance over Christina Hammer this past Saturday in Atlantic City.

        I have no issue with a fighter wanting to hype their achievements. Claressa might end up being the greatest female boxer of all time.

        But there has to be at least a general understanding of the scope of her achievement. There are 32 professional female middleweight fighters in the world. If she moved up to Super middleweight there are only 22.

        In the context of her opponents she is clearly a level above but the comments about her going on some kind of inter gender p4p list sound like political correctness gone insane.
